3. Nansen.ai

True analytical data is one of the most logical ways to identify NFT gems. Therefore, Nansen puts that power in an accessible fashion for its users. 

Nansen aggregates buyer data from Opensea and breaks it down into easy-to-digest graphs and analytics. Users can see where the smart money is going, or in other words, see what the markets’ most influential buyers are buying and holding.

Also, you can set alerts to notify you when specific wallets mint or buy a new collection. You can also see what the hottest groups are for each week.

4. RyzeNFT

RyzeNFT is an expensive but powerful tool for finding undervalued NFTs and acting quickly. Ryze Solutions is a secret tool before being adapted for NFTs. With the NFT extension, users get access to various incredibly powerful tools.

  • Rarity sniffer: This allows you to see rarity rankings right on opensea. 
  • Mint sniping tools: Allow you to automatically mint from the contract the second a mint opens, helping you skip over any gas war. 
  • The OpenSea sniper allows you to set a max price to sweep floors on underpriced NFTs. 

Therefore, Ryze automatically watches this collection, and if anyone posts well below the floor looking for quick liquidity, Ryze notifies you to allow you to purchase it quickly. 

Also, Ryze sells access to this Tool in the form of an NFT. Available for 0.94 ETH plus a 0.08ETH monthly subscription. A lifetime subscription is available for 3.89 ETH. 6. The Road Map

The roadmap map is one of the most important documents given to the public for essentially every Project. This is the list of upcoming events, drops, and important dates for the Project. The roadmap can be one of the most telling parts of a successful NFT project. 

If you are investing in a project for the longer term, a roadmap with strong long-term events is something you should be looking for. Additionally, roadmaps with tons of unrealistic short-term promises are red flags. These are often used to pump the price before a rug pull. These promises come in the form of free airdrops, tokens, benefits, and more.

Therefore, sniffing these red flags out, typically coupled with anonymous, price/floor-oriented devs, is essential in finding rug pulls. On the other hand, a roadmap is a collection guide to the future. Also, deciphering these guides and finding new innovative road maps is key to discovering the most profitable NFT projects.

Finally, a roadmap is typically found on the project website or social media, and it should be one of the first things you look at before investing in a new collection.

7. Icy Tools

Icy Tool is a subscription-based platform that gives minute-by-minute trends in the NFT market. Instead of using OpenSea to watch trends, let Icy Tools aggregate all the data for you.

In the free plan, Icy Tools provides hourly and daily trends. With a $62/month subscription, you get access to 15m and 30m trends, track wallets and get alerts for when they buy, sell, mint, as well as hot mint alerts. 

While this may seem like a steep investment, one lead on a hot mint could pay for your subscription for the entire year. So Icy is a worthwhile investment for analytically focused traders looking for a user-friendly UI.

10. Look at the Project

Finally, the most important aspect to finding valuable NFT projects is to look at the Project yourself. First, you need to invest in projects that interest you. Simply buying what everyone else is buying, or what the trends are showing, will lead to anxiety-induced paper hands and bad decision making. 

When you invest in projects that you understand, have an interest in, you will be able to sit through some of the bad days. Trading on what everyone else is doing will only lead to you being stuck with illiquid jpegs.  

Also, users need to look at the Project and determine what makes this collection unique from every other one on the market. Therefore, you can use these tools to see what everyone else is buying is helpful, but to make money long-term in this market, you need to understand WHY people are buying. 

You can spot trends and categories before these websites find them as you progress. Treat these websites to confirm or deny your hypotheses. Spending quality time looking at projects, seeing what’s successful and what isn’t can help you become a successful NFT trader.
